How much does it cost to rent an apartment in South of Katella?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| South of Katella Studio Apartments | $2,025 | $1,568 | $2,602 |
| South of Katella 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,504 | $1,675 | $3,409 |
| South of Katella 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,929 | $1,850 | $4,298 |
| South of Katella 3 Bedroom Apartments | $3,010 | $2,825 | $3,100 |
| South of Katella 4 Bedroom Apartments | $4,700 | $4,700 | $4,700 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Utilities Included South of Katella Apartments
What is the Cheapest Utilities Included apartment in South of Katella?
Currently the most affordable Utilities Included Apartment in South of Katella is at Villas Apartments Homes listed at $1,675.
How much is the average rent for a Utilities Included South of Katella Apartment?
The average rent for a Utilities Included Apartment in South of Katella is $2,271.
What is the largest Utilities Included South of Katella Apartment for rent?
Today's Utilities Included apartment with the most square footage in South of Katella is a 1,170 square feet unit starting from $1,980 at Palm West Village.
